Course structure

• Introduction to Wetland Insect Community Ecology
• Wetland Insect Diversity and Taxonomy
• Sampling and Monitoring Techniques for Wetland Insects
• Wetland Insect Population Dynamics
• Wetland Insect Interactions with Plants
• Wetland Insect Responses to Environmental Change
• Conservation and Management of Wetland Insect Communities
• Wetland Insect Community Ecology Research Methods
• Wetland Insect Community Ecology Case Studies
